About The Position

This role is responsible for managing, retaining, and growing a portfolio of high-valued Commercial Market clients with deposit accounts and relationships. The primary focus is on new core deposit acquisition and generating new business relationships for the bank. The position also involves assisting with the development of product collateral and documentation, providing technical support, and aiding in the maintenance of products and services sold. Client product training and integration with other Commercial Markets to generate new business are also key aspects of the role. The officer will support cash management product and service sales calls with product demonstrations and presentations, and for Senior roles, support Merchant and Cash Management products and services sales calls.
